CSC ServiceWorks, Inc. has appointed two new members to the company’s Board of Directors. They are Alex Hawkinson, founder and former CEO of SmartThings, the largest consumer Internet of Things platform in the world; and Rick Graf, president and CEO of Pinnacle, one of the nation’s leading multifamily management firms.

Hawkinson has more than 20 years of experience in technology and development. In 2012, he founded SmartThings, where he grew the company into a global platform, servicing more than 100 million customers with billions of connected devices across the globe. Prior to its acquisition by Samsung in 2014, SmartThings led the industry with its uniquely open platform, which attracted tens of thousands of developers and device makers to integrate with the platform, together creating security solutions, energy savings, entertainment and more for customers worldwide.

Prior to his founding of SmartThings, Hawkinson led and founded a number of technology companies across the United States, including SMBLive, an online marketing platform with products serving more than 300,000 small businesses in the United States and the United Kingdom; Mural, a multi-national SaaS strategic consulting and support company; Apptix, the largest provider of hosted messaging and collaboration products for small to medium-sized businesses; HostOne, a joint venture between Microsoft and USWeb; and USWeb DC, the leading web consultancy in the Washington, D.C., region.

As an active investor in early-stage technology companies and a director on several boards, Hawkinson utilizes his vast knowledge and experience to continuously aid in the further development of the industry.

Hawkinson holds a bachelor’s degree in cognitive science from Carnegie Mellon University.

Graf, in his role as president and CEO of Pinnacle, provides strategic oversight for the company’s vision and long-term growth, while managing a spectrum of assets for major institutional clients across several states. He has held a variety of positions at Pinnacle since joining in 1996 and previously oversaw an expansive regional profile for the company.

In addition to his 40 years of experience in the real estate industry, Graf is a Certified Property Manager. He is also active in the National Multifamily Housing Council, the Institute of Real Estate Management, the National Association of Home Builders and the National Apartment Association (NAA), of which he serves on the Board of Directors as vice chair. Graf is also a former president of the Texas Apartment Association.
